Council Tax Bill Charges by Band
The data is sourced from Stockport Council.
Following are details about tax rates for eight house tax bands set by local authority/council Stockport. Check your property tax band and map in below table to find your house council tax rates.
- Authority Name
Stockport, Greater Manchester
- Type
Metropolitan Areas
- Anual Rate Change
3.5%
Tax band | Rate for year 2021/22 | Rate for year 2022/23 | Percentage change |
---|---|---|---|
A | £1,373 | £1,428 | 3.5% |
B | £1,602 | £1,666 | 3.5% |
C | £1,830 | £1,904 | 3.5% |
D | £2,059 | £2,142 | 3.5% |
E | £2,517 | £2,618 | 3.5% |
F | £2,974 | £3,095 | 3.5% |
G | £3,432 | £3,571 | 3.5% |
H | £4,118 | £4,285 | 3.5% |
